食肉卸売市場調査(牛)データ取得API:GetByDays/{TargetDate}
- 公開日
- 更新日 2024-11-19
利用条件
無償オプションAPI(申込必要)
概要
API名称
食肉卸売市場調査(牛)データ取得API:GetByDays/{TargetDate}
カテゴリー
説明
農林水産省が提供する、全国の食肉中央卸売市場における牛の市場別卸売数量(頭数)や価格等の日別データです。2010年4月以降のデータが取得できます。 ※畜産物流通調査の概要(農林水産省Webサイト) https://www.maff.go.jp/j/tokei/kouhyou/tikusan_ryutu/gaiyou/index.html
本APIの利用にあたっては利用規約への同意の上、別途利用申請が必要ですので、ご利用の際は
「農業データ連携基盤(WAGRI)利⽤・変更申請ページ」
https://wagri-subscription.db.naro.go.jp/ords/r/prd/subscription/pre-registration
からご申請をお願い申し上げます。
■API利用マニュアル・利用規約等の詳細:添付ファイル「農林水産省オープンデータAPIの利用マニュアル、利用規約」
添付ファイル
農林水産省オープンデータAPIの利用マニュアル、利用規約
説明
利用承諾後、APIの利用者権限を付与し、申請いただいたご担当者様のメールアドレス宛にご連絡します。
データの更新頻度
1日1回 11:45ごろ
リクエスト
新URL
New!
ー
旧URL(2025年度末で終了予定)
https://api.wagri.net/API/MaffOpenData/Private/BeefWholesaleMarketSurvey/GetByDays/{TargetDate}
説明
登録されている食肉卸売市場調査(牛)のデータを日付を指定して取得できます。
HTTPメソッド
GET
パラメータ
ー
新呼出例
New!
ー
旧呼出例2025年度末で終了予定)
https://api.wagri.net/API/MaffOpenData/Private/BeefWholesaleMarketSurvey/GetByDays/{TargetDate}
レスポンス
レイアウト
レスポンスデータ定義
BeefWholesaleMarketSurvey
名称 | 型 | サイズ | 値の説明 |
---|---|---|---|
BeefWholesaleMarketSurveyId | 牛肉卸売市場調査ID | string | Required |
BreedCode | 畜種コード | string | Required Max Length: 5 |
BreedName | 畜種名 | string | Required Max Length: 100 |
Date | 日 | integer | Required Maximum: 31 |
MarketCode | 市場コード | string | Required Max Length: 5 |
MarketName | 市場名 | string | Required Max Length: 25 |
Month | 月 | integer | Required Maximum: 12 |
NumberOfTrades1 | 取引成立頭数(規格1) | integer, null | Maximum: 999999999 |
NumberOfTrades1NonNumeric | 取引成立頭数(規格1)(非数値) | string, null | Max Length: 10 |
NumberOfTrades2 | 取引成立頭数(規格2) | integer, null | Maximum: 999999999 |
NumberOfTrades2NonNumeric | 取引成立頭数(規格2)(非数値) | string, null | Max Length: 10 |
NumberOfTrades3 | 取引成立頭数(規格3) | integer, null | Maximum: 999999999 |
NumberOfTrades3NonNumeric | 取引成立頭数(規格3)(非数値) | string, null | Max Length: 10 |
NumberOfTrades4 | 取引成立頭数(規格4) | integer, null | Maximum: 999999999 |
NumberOfTrades4NonNumeric | 取引成立頭数(規格4)(非数値) | string, null | Max Length: 10 |
NumberOfTrades5 | 取引成立頭数(規格5) | integer, null | Maximum: 999999999 |
NumberOfTrades5NonNumeric | 取引成立頭数(規格5)(非数値) | string, null | Max Length: 10 |
NumberOfTradesAverageNonNumeric | 取引価格(平均)(非数値) | string, null | Max Length: 10 |
NumberOfTradesTotal | 取引成立頭数(計) | integer, null | Maximum: 999999999 |
TargetDate | 年月日 | string | Required Format: date-time |
TotalNumberOfTradesNonNumeric | 取引成立頭数(計)(非数値) | string, null | Max Length: 10 |
TotalTradingPrice | 取引価額(計)(千円) | integer, null | Maximum: 999999999 |
TotalTradingValueNonNumeric | 取引価額(計)(非数値) | string, null | Max Length: 10 |
TotalTradingWeight | 取引重量(計)(kg) | integer, null | Maximum: 999999999 |
TotalTradingWeightNonNumeric | 取引重量(計)(非数値) | string, null | Max Length: 10 |
TradingPrice1 | 取引価格(規格1)(円/kg) | integer, null | Maximum: 999999999 |
TradingPrice1NonNumeric | 取引価格(規格1)(非数値) | string, null | Max Length: 10 |
TradingPrice2 | 取引価格(規格2)(円/kg) | integer, null | Maximum: 999999999 |
TradingPrice2NonNumeric | 取引価格(規格2)(非数値) | string, null | Max Length: 10 |
TradingPrice3 | 取引価格(規格3)(円/kg) | integer, null | Maximum: 999999999 |
TradingPrice3NonNumeric | 取引価格(規格3)(非数値) | string, null | Max Length: 10 |
TradingPrice4 | 取引価格(規格4)(円/kg) | integer, null | Maximum: 999999999 |
TradingPrice4NonNumeric | 取引価格(規格4)(非数値) | string, null | Max Length: 10 |
TradingPrice5 | 取引価格(規格5)(円/kg) | integer, null | Maximum: 999999999 |
TradingPrice5NonNumeric | 取引価格(規格5)(非数値) | string, null | Max Length: 10 |
TradingPriceAverage | 取引価格(平均)(円/kg) | integer, null | Maximum: 999999999 |
WeekDay | 曜日 | string | Required Max Length: 1 |
Year | 年 | integer | Required Maximum: 9999 |
レスポンス説明
食肉卸売市場調査(牛)
レスポンス例
ー
ステータスコード
コード | 名称 | 値の説明 |
---|---|---|
400 | Bad Request | リクエストが不正です。 |
403 | Forbidden | リソースのアクセスが禁止されています。 |
500 | Internal Server Error | サーバー内部でエラーが発生しました。 |
401 | Unauthorized | 認証情報が不正です。 |
サンプルソースコード
プログラム記述例(WAGRI共通)
import requests url = "https://api.wagri.net/API/Public/AgriculturalLand/SearchByCityCode" payload = { 'CityCode': '432041' } headers = { 'X-Authorization': 'アクセストークン', } response = requests.get(url, headers=headers, params=payload) print(response.text)
プログラム記述例(個別API)
ー